I hate to play the "remember when" card but a few years ago there was good reason to have a DBS LNB
-40 audio only channels on 91W
-about 30 radio stations from Canada on 91W

-Dish "home" channel on 110. This was a 6 screen channel that Dish uses for like a "mix" channel so it could be all sports channels or all news. You could select the audio for each one
-the CD and mono audio channels on 119 (Sirius was scrambled)
-Dish 101, Nasa, Angel One, Ion on 119
-a PBS from Ohio on 129
